# #bb77af

A color — warm, muted, editorial, elegant. Deterministic analysis from BrandSweets (no inference).

## Values

- Hex: `#bb77af`
- RGB: rgb(187, 119, 175)
- HSL: hsl(311, 33%, 60%)
- OKLCH: oklch(0.659 0.112 333.4)
- Relative luminance: 0.2685
- Nearest named color: Berries Galore (#ab7cb4, Δ 2.819) — https://brandsweets.com/colors/berries-galore
- Moods: warm, muted, editorial, elegant

##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 3.3:1 — AA fail,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#ab599c (4.53:1); AA: background → #262626 (4.59:1); AAA: text → #814175 (7.13:1)
- On black (#000000): 6.37: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AAA: text → #c082b4 (7.09:1)
